What it means

The meaning of Zainab Maryam Abubakar

“Zainab is an Arabic feminine name, written زينب, and is often connected with beauty, fragrance, flowers, and plant imagery. In the full Nigerian name Zainab Maryam Abubakar, it has a graceful Muslim naming feel with strong Hausa and wider Arabic-language familiarity.”

Zainab Maryam Abubakar is a name with a calm, dignified sound and a very familiar rhythm in many Nigerian Muslim families. The first name, Zainab, is a feminine Arabic name written as زينب. Behind the Name lists Zainab as an Arabic, Urdu, Hausa, Malay, and Indonesian form, which tells you something lovely right away: this is not a name that belongs to just one place. It has traveled through language, faith, family, and everyday use. For meaning, Zainab is usually treated as a name with gentle natural imagery. Name references connect it with beauty, flowers, fragrance, nature, and plants, so it carries a soft but polished feeling. It does not sound frilly. It sounds composed. A little girl named Zainab can grow into the name easily because it has both sweetness and seriousness. Maryam adds another familiar layer for Muslim families, especially because it sits so naturally beside Zainab in Arabic-influenced naming. Even without treating the whole combination as one ancient fixed name, Zainab Maryam feels balanced: two names with religious warmth, clear pronunciation, and a sense of family respect. Abubakar gives the full name a distinctly West African and Nigerian Muslim shape. In Nigeria, names like this often carry more than sound. They can point to faith, community, family history, and the kind of elders a child is being welcomed by. The full name also closely resembles that of Dr. Zainab Marwa-Abubakar, a Nigerian public figure known for women’s advocacy, NGO work, and political involvement, which gives the combination a real contemporary Nigerian reference point. Parents who like Zainab Maryam Abubakar are often choosing something that feels graceful, serious, and rooted. It is easy to say, rich in cultural connection, and strong enough for every age.

Heritage

Cultural & religious significance

Zainab has deep cultural and religious resonance in Muslim communities because of one especially important bearer: Zainab bint Muhammad, the eldest daughter of the Islamic prophet Muhammad and Khadija bint Khuwaylid. Her name gives Zainab a place in early Islamic memory, so for many families it feels respectful, faith-filled, and historically warm. The name is also widely used across languages shaped by Arabic and Islamic naming traditions. Behind the Name lists Zainab in Arabic, Urdu, Hausa, Malay, and Indonesian usage, and gives related forms in several other languages. That matters for a Nigerian girl because Hausa usage makes Zainab feel right at home in northern Nigerian and wider Muslim Nigerian naming patterns, while the Arabic script and pronunciation keep it tied to a broader global tradition. There is no special taboo attached to the name in the source material, but families often treat names connected with respected religious figures with care. In real life, that usually means spelling it clearly, teaching children its pronunciation, and understanding why older relatives may feel fond of it. The name can be formal on documents and affectionate at home, especially with nicknames like Zee, Zai, or Zainy. As a full name, Zainab Maryam Abubakar sounds Nigerian, Muslim, and polished. It has a public-facing strength, the kind of name that would look natural on a school certificate, a medical coat, a campaign poster, or a family wedding program.

Fun facts about Zainab Maryam Abubakar

  • Zainab is written زينب in Arabic script.
  • Behind the Name lists Zainab as used in Arabic, Urdu, Hausa, Malay, and Indonesian.
  • The form Zainabu is listed as a Hausa variant of Zainab.
  • Zainab was ranked #138 in England and Wales in 2024, according to Behind the Name.
  • Zainab bint Muhammad was the eldest daughter of the Islamic prophet Muhammad.
  • Zainab has related forms in languages including Turkish, Somali, Persian, and Bosnian.

Frequently asked questions about Zainab Maryam Abubakar

What does the name Zainab Maryam Abubakar mean?
Zainab is an Arabic feminine name often connected in name references with beauty, flowers, fragrance, nature, and plants. Maryam and Abubakar give the full name a familiar Nigerian Muslim sound with strong family and faith associations.
Is Zainab Maryam Abubakar a girl name?
Yes. Zainab is listed as a feminine name, and Zainab Maryam Abubakar is a girl’s name with Arabic, Hausa, and Nigerian Muslim familiarity.
How do you pronounce Zainab?
Zainab is commonly pronounced ZY-nab, with two syllables. The IPA form listed by Behind the Name is /ˈzaj.nab/.
Is Zainab a popular name?
Zainab has visible international use. Behind the Name lists it as #807 in the United States in 2025, #138 in England and Wales in 2024, and top 10 in Iraq and Pakistan.
